Transaction 95c7afd8ad5f084d584daf8556cfe5d11052b12622ea28c20f191cd26e8b8055
1 Input
1 Output
-
95c7afd8ad5f084d584daf8556cfe5d11052b12622ea28c20f191cd26e8b8055:0
- value
- 852708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72509d8f872c1fbf4a71ad1311327748e3c1b31c OP_EQUAL
- address
- 3C7TXg28KL3AiwNjcBd4m7RH4YxPW9b43n